Practical approaches that deliver value
– Design for longevity and disassembly: Create products that are easy to repair, upgrade, or recycle.
Modular design lowers end-of-life costs and supports resale or refurbishment programs.
– Shift to service models: Moving from one-time sales to subscriptions or leasing captures ongoing revenue and incentives to maintain product quality, which drives longer lifespans and less waste.
– Close material loops: Partner with suppliers and reverse-logistics providers to collect end-of-use items and reintegrate recovered materials into production.
– Use digital tools smartly: Sensors, connected-device data, digital twins, and advanced analytics can track asset health, optimize maintenance, and predict end-of-life timing—extending useful life and reducing downtime.
– Explore alternative materials and processes: Biobased materials, recycled feedstocks, and additive manufacturing techniques can reduce resource intensity and enable localized production, cutting transport emissions.
Measuring progress and avoiding greenwashing
Reliable metrics are essential. Track circularity indicators such as material recovery rates, product lifetime extension, and lifecycle greenhouse gas reductions. Financial metrics—cost per use, residual value recaptured, and new recurring revenue—make the business case visible to stakeholders. Transparent reporting and third-party verification build credibility and protect against accusations of greenwashing.
Common barriers and how to overcome them
– Internal silos: Sustainability often spans product design, procurement, operations, and sales.
Create cross-functional teams and align incentives so everyone shares responsibility for circular outcomes.
– Upfront costs: Transitioning to circular models can require capital. Start with pilots that demonstrate payback through lower material costs, reduced waste, or new revenue streams.
– Supply-chain complexity: Mapping material flows is challenging but necessary.
Prioritize high-impact components and work with strategic suppliers to trial material recovery or take-back schemes.
– Consumer behavior: Not all customers will adopt service models immediately. Offer hybrid options—repair and upgrade services alongside traditional purchases—to ease the shift.
Scaling sustainable innovation inside organizations
Begin with quick wins to build momentum: retrofit existing products for repairability, pilot a refurbishment program, or introduce a leasing option for a single product line.
Capture lessons, refine operations, and scale promising pilots. Use digital platforms to manage reverse logistics and customer engagement, and publish clear performance data to earn trust and support from regulators, investors, and customers.
